// Broker upgrade notes for plugin authors:
// Quillbus 4.x replaces the legacy 3.x wire protocol. Plugins must
// construct the client with explicit protocol negotiation enabled,
// or connections to the Larkfield cluster will be silently downgraded
// and dropped after 30s. Topic names are unchanged. For local testing
// against the sandbox broker, authenticate with the key below.

API key for bafof-bagaf: qvz2-qi

Subject: Joint Venture Proposal — Marrowgate Energy

Executive team,

For the board's consideration: Marrowgate Energy has proposed a joint venture to develop the Selvern Basin storage facility. Our share would be 45%, with governance split across a five-seat committee. Legal has flagged two clauses requiring renegotiation, and finance is stress-testing the capital schedule. Full papers arrive Friday. The strategic rationale, which remains confidential, is set out in the note below.

management briefing: Project Ulavan slips by two quarters because of the staffing delay.

Hey Marek — handing over the dependency pinning work before I'm out. Short version for your security review: everything in the Bramblewick monorepo is now pinned to exact versions with hashes, no ranges, no floating tags. Renovation of transitive deps happens weekly via an automated PR, and anything flagged by the vuln scanner gets fast-tracked. The one wart: two legacy services still pull from the old unpinned mirror; tickets are filed. Exceptions need your sign-off now. The full policy and exception log live on the internal page below.

operations page: https://jenkins.zemvarcloud.local/job/merge_requests/repo/build/73930b4b30f0a8ed